Affected Products

Omni Micro-electrode/reference electrode for cobas b221 analyzer, Model/Catalog/Part Number: 03111873180 as a part of the following systems: 1. 03337103001, cobas b 221<1>Roche OMNI S1 system 2. 03337111001, cobas b 221<2>Roche OMNI S2 system 3. 03337154001,cobas b 221<6>Roche OMNI S6 system 4. 03337138001, cobas b 221<4>Roche OMNI S4 system Product Usage: Usage: Blood Gas and Electrolytes Analyzer c. Classification Name: Fully automated Critical Care Analyzer for the measurement of pH, Blood gases, electrolytes, Hematocrit, hemoglobin, glucose, lactate, urea/BUN, total hemoglobin, Oxygen saturation, oxy - deoxycarboxy and methemoglobin

Quantity: N/A

Why Was This Recalled?

Reference electrode used beyond the guaranteed in-use 52 week lifetime,may leak and potentially cause erroneous pH and/or sodium results. Other Ion parameters are not affected.
